基本信息

案例ID:240905

技术顾问:鲜榨柠檬气泡水 - 7年经验 - 阿里云计算有限公司

联系沟通

微信扫码,建群沟通

项目名称:企业级后台管理系统

所属行业:企业服务 - 数据服务

->查看更多案例

案例介绍

项目简介:独立搭建并迭代基于 Umi4 + Ant Design Pro 的企业级后台管理系统,采用 React Hooks + TypeScript 开发,依托Umi路由、权限、工程化体系,实现多角色权限管控、用户管理、流程审批、大数据可视化等核心业务。有效解决传统后台权限混乱、组件复用低、大数据渲染卡顿、全面提升系统运维效率与业务落地能力。
技术栈:Umi4、React Hooks、TypeScript、Ant Design Pro、Redux、Axios、React Query、ES6+、Mock
核心职责与技术亮点
1. 安全登录架构设计:基于Umi路由守卫与axios拦截器搭建企业级登录体系,实现登录态持久化、Token过期自动刷新、异地互踢、权限拦截。通过TS全局类型约束,完成密码加密、验证码校验、登录日志统计,区分多角色登录权限,保障系统访问安全可控。
2. 多用户管理模块开发:实现系统用户全生命周期管理,支持用户新增、编辑、禁用、批量导入导出、密码重置、部门与角色绑定。结合全局状态同步用户状态,联动权限系统自动同步角色权限,搭配多条件搜索、分页筛选功能
3. 自定义流程审批功能:开发可配置式多级流程审批模块,适配报销、请假、报备等通用业务场景。支持流程节点配置、多级审批、驳回重提、撤销申请、审批记录溯源,通过表单状态监听动态控制按钮权限与页面渲染,解决异步审批卡顿、状态延迟问题,实现业务流程线上标准化。
4. 复杂表单联动开发:封装高阶业务表单,实现字段级联联动、动态显隐、增减表单项、数据回显、跨字段关联等复杂交互。自定义通用表单校验规则,结合Hooks精准监听字段变化,解决表单联动错乱、渲染异常问题,提升复杂业务表单的数据准确性与填写效率。
5. 大数据表格性能优化:针对大数据渲染场景做深度性能优化,采用虚拟列表、懒加载、防抖搜索、数据缓存等方案,解决大数量卡顿、白屏问题。实现表格排序、筛选、列拖拽、单元格自定义渲染、批量操作、数据导出等功能,保障海量数据高效展示与操作。
6. 核心组件二次封装:基于AntD原生组件统一封装企业级通用组件,提升项目复用性与规范性:封装通用表格,整合分页、筛选、权限按钮、导出、空状态处理;封装全局弹窗,统一新增/编辑/查看场景样式与加载逻辑;封装通用业务表单,内置控件、校验、联动规则,大幅降低重复编码量。

发布任务

企业点击发布任务,工程师会在任务下报名,招聘专员也会在1小时内与您联系,1小时内精准确定人才

微信接收人才推送

关注猿急送微信平台,接收实时人才推送

接收人才推送
联系需求方端客服
联系需求方端客服